To truly understand web hosting, you must first grasp its fundamental role in making websites accessible online. You’ll learn to understand web hosting, its types, and how to choose the best option for your needs. This guide offers a comprehensive overview, equipping you with the knowledge to make informed decisions about your online presence.
Table of Contents
- What is Web Hosting?
- Types of Web Hosting Explained
- What is web hosting in simple terms?
- Which hosting is best for beginners?
- What is the difference between hosting and a domain?
- Do I need SSL for my website?
- What’s the difference between cloud and shared hosting?
- What is a VPS?
- What is managed WordPress hosting?
- How much storage and bandwidth do I need?
- What does “uptime” mean in hosting?
- Is it easy to switch hosting providers?
- Does web hosting include email accounts?
- How do I keep my site secure on shared hosting?
- Do I need a CDN with my hosting?
- How often should I back up my website?
- How much does hosting typically cost?
- Which performance metrics matter most?
- How do I scale hosting as traffic grows?
- Do hosts offer trials or refunds?
- How do I register a domain name?
- What is a control panel?
- Can I use a website builder with hosting?
- What is a dedicated server?
- Does server location matter?
- What is HTTPS and why is it important?
- How do I migrate my website to a new host?
- What is caching and how does it improve performance?
- Do I need a database for my website?
- What are the best security practices for web hosting?
- What are some useful website monitoring tools?
- What are some future trends in web hosting?
- Important Points
We Also Published
Mastering Web Hosting: A Comprehensive Guide
Web hosting is the backbone of any online presence. Understanding its nuances is crucial for website owners, developers, and anyone looking to establish a digital footprint. In this guide, we'll explore the essential aspects of web hosting, from its basic concepts to advanced strategies, helping you to understand web hosting thoroughly.
What is Web Hosting?
Web hosting is a service that provides the infrastructure for storing and serving your website's content on the internet. It involves renting or owning space on a server, which is a powerful computer connected to the internet, to store your website's files. When a user types your domain name into their browser, the hosting server delivers the website's files, allowing the user to view your site. Web hosting ensures that your website is accessible 24/7, providing a reliable online presence for your audience.
Types of Web Hosting Explained
Choosing the right hosting type is essential. Each option offers different features, resources, and levels of control. Selecting the suitable hosting type can significantly impact your website's performance, scalability, and cost-effectiveness. Here's a breakdown of common web hosting types and their ideal use cases. Consider your website's needs when choosing.
What is web hosting in simple terms?
Web hosting is like renting space on the internet for your website. It's where your website's files live, so people can see your site when they type in your domain name. The web host provides the server, storage, and other resources needed to keep your website up and running.
Which hosting is best for beginners?
Shared hosting is often the best choice for beginners. It's affordable, easy to manage, and includes features like a control panel and one-click installers. It's a good starting point for small websites with moderate traffic.
What is the difference between hosting and a domain?
A domain name is your website's address (e.g., example.com), while web hosting is the physical space where your website's files are stored. You need both a domain and hosting for your website to be live on the internet.
Do I need SSL for my website?
Yes, SSL (Secure Sockets Layer) is crucial. It encrypts data between the user's browser and your website, protecting sensitive information. SSL also boosts trust and improves your website's search engine ranking.
What’s the difference between cloud and shared hosting?
Shared hosting puts multiple websites on one server, sharing resources. Cloud hosting uses a network of servers, offering better scalability, reliability, and performance. Cloud hosting is more flexible and can handle traffic spikes better.
What is a VPS?
A VPS (Virtual Private Server) is a virtual server that provides dedicated resources on a shared physical server. It offers more control and performance than shared hosting, suitable for websites with moderate traffic and resource needs.
What is managed WordPress hosting?
Managed WordPress hosting is a specialized hosting service optimized for WordPress websites. It includes features like automatic updates, security enhancements, and expert support, simplifying website management.
How much storage and bandwidth do I need?
The required storage and bandwidth depend on your website's size and traffic. Small sites may need 1–10 GB of storage and moderate bandwidth. High-traffic or media-rich sites require more resources. Monitor your usage and upgrade as needed.
What does “uptime” mean in hosting?
Uptime is the percentage of time your website is accessible. Hosting providers often guarantee a certain uptime percentage, like 99.9%. High uptime is vital for ensuring your website is consistently available to visitors.
Is it easy to switch hosting providers?
Switching hosting providers can be straightforward. Most providers offer migration assistance or tools to transfer your website files. Plan your migration carefully, back up your website, and minimize downtime.
Does web hosting include email accounts?
Many hosting plans include email accounts. However, you can also use external email services like Google Workspace for better features, deliverability, and integration with other tools.
How do I keep my site secure on shared hosting?
Enhance security with strong passwords, two-factor authentication, regular software updates, and a web application firewall (WAF). Also, schedule backups and use malware scanning to protect your website.
Do I need a CDN with my hosting?
A CDN (Content Delivery Network) is highly recommended. It caches your website's content on servers worldwide, reducing latency and improving loading times for visitors, especially those far from your main server location.
How often should I back up my website?
Back up your website regularly, preferably daily, to ensure data safety. Store backups off-site and have a quick restore process in place. Backups protect you from data loss due to various issues.
How much does hosting typically cost?
Hosting costs vary depending on the type and resources. Shared hosting can start from a few dollars per month. VPS, cloud, and managed plans are more expensive, offering more features, performance, and support.
Which performance metrics matter most?
Key performance metrics include Time To First Byte (TTFB), Largest Contentful Paint (LCP), and uptime. Combining quality hosting with caching, image optimization, and a CDN improves your website's Core Web Vitals.
How do I scale hosting as traffic grows?
As your website's traffic increases, upgrade your hosting plan. Consider moving from shared hosting to a VPS or cloud hosting. Utilize autoscaling features if available, and optimize your database and CDN setup.
Do hosts offer trials or refunds?
Many hosting providers offer money-back guarantees, often ranging from 7 to 30 days. Read the terms carefully, as certain services, like domain names, may not be included in the refund.
How do I register a domain name?
You can register a domain name through a domain registrar or a web hosting provider. Choose a domain name that reflects your brand, and consider using a domain name generator if needed.
What is a control panel?
A control panel (like cPanel or Plesk) simplifies website management. It provides a user-friendly interface for managing files, email accounts, databases, and other aspects of your hosting.
Can I use a website builder with hosting?
Yes, many hosting providers offer website builders or integrate with them. Website builders allow you to create a website without coding knowledge, making it easy for beginners.
What is a dedicated server?
A dedicated server provides you with an entire server for your website. It offers the highest level of performance, control, and resources, suitable for high-traffic websites.
Does server location matter?
Yes, the server location impacts your website's loading speed. Choose a server location that's closest to your target audience to reduce latency and improve user experience.
What is HTTPS and why is it important?
HTTPS (Hypertext Transfer Protocol Secure) encrypts data transmitted between your website and visitors' browsers. It is crucial for security, protects sensitive information, and boosts your website's search engine rankings.
How do I migrate my website to a new host?
Migrating involves backing up your website files and database, transferring them to your new host, and updating your DNS settings. Many hosts offer migration services to assist you.
What is caching and how does it improve performance?
Caching stores static versions of your website's pages, reducing server load and improving loading times. Caching helps your website deliver content faster to visitors.
Do I need a database for my website?
Most dynamic websites require a database to store and manage content. Databases organize and store information, allowing you to easily update and retrieve data.
What are the best security practices for web hosting?
Implement strong passwords, enable two-factor authentication, keep your software updated, use a web application firewall (WAF), and regularly back up your website. These practices enhance your website's security.
What are some useful website monitoring tools?
Use tools like Google Analytics, UptimeRobot, and Pingdom to monitor your website's performance, uptime, and security. Monitoring helps you identify and address issues promptly.
What are some future trends in web hosting?
Future trends include serverless computing, edge computing, and AI-powered hosting solutions. These advancements aim to improve performance, scalability, and automation.
Important Points
Web hosting is more than just storage; it's the foundation of your online success. Selecting the right hosting plan, optimizing performance, and prioritizing security are essential for a thriving website. By understanding and implementing the best practices, you can ensure your website is fast, reliable, and secure.
Similar Problems (Quick Solutions)
What is the difference between HTTP and HTTPS?
HTTPS uses SSL/TLS encryption for secure data transfer; HTTP does not.
What is a DNS?
DNS (Domain Name System) translates domain names into IP addresses.
What are the benefits of a CDN?
CDNs speed up website loading times by caching content on servers worldwide.
How do I choose a web hosting provider?
Consider your website's needs, compare plans, and read reviews to select the best provider.
What is the difference between a static and dynamic website?
Static websites deliver the same content to every visitor; dynamic websites generate content on the fly.
References
To master web hosting, start with the basics: understand server types, choose a suitable hosting plan, and ensure your site's security. Study web server technologies, explore content delivery networks, and learn about database management. Key resources include hosting provider documentation, web development forums, and online courses. Continuous learning and adaptation are key to staying ahead in the rapidly evolving world of web hosting.
| Hosting Type | Description | Use Cases |
|---|---|---|
| Shared Hosting | Multiple websites on one server, sharing resources. | Beginner websites, blogs, small businesses. |
| VPS (Virtual Private Server) | Dedicated resources on a shared server. | Websites with moderate traffic and resource needs. |
| Cloud Hosting | Resources distributed across multiple servers. | Scalable websites, high-traffic sites. |
| Managed WordPress Hosting | Optimized for WordPress websites. | WordPress sites needing specialized support. |
| Dedicated Server | Entire server for one website. | High-traffic websites, large businesses. |
Also Read
RESOURCES
- No results found.
From our network :
- Bitcoin price analysis: Market signals after a muted weekend
- Limits: The Squeeze Theorem Explained
- Limit Superior and Inferior
- The Diverse Types of Convergence in Mathematics
- How to migrate to postgres using logical replication and cutover
- Bitcoin Hits $100K: Crypto News Digest
- JD Vance Charlie Kirk: Tribute and Political Strategy
- How to design postgres partitions with native and hash methods
- How to secure postgres connections across VPC, VPN, and cloud